By India Today Web Desk: Pakistan left-arm pacer Shaheen Shah Afridi hobbled off the sector after selecting up an harm towards England within the ultimate of the ICC Men’s T20 World Cup.

In what was an enormous blow for Pakistan, their main tempo bowler limped off the sector after selecting up an harm. Afridi appeared to have picked up an harm whereas taking Harry Brook’s catch in additional covers off Shadab Khan’s bowling.

Afridi was trying in immense type, cleansing up the damaging Alex Hales in his very first over. Afridi bowled an in-swinger and the right-handed Hales didn’t have any clue concerning the peach of a supply from the left-armer. Hales missed the ball, which deflected from his pads on to the stumps.

He had bowled 2 overs, giving freely 13 runs and selecting up one wicket. But the harm pressured him off the sector. However, the 22-year-old got here again onto the sector and even bowled the primary ball of his third over however couldn’t proceed, citing ache in his knee.

Afridi had simply recovered in time for the T20 World Cup after being doubtful for the match. Afridi had sustained a ligament harm to his proper knee, whereas touring Sri Lanka with the Test group in July.

Former Pakistan pacer Wahab Riaz despatched needs to Afridi after he sustained an harm within the T20 World Cup ultimate, calling him a star for Pakistan cricket.

“I can feel for you @iShaheenAfridi. You have always given your best bro. You’re a star for Pakistan. Your fighting instinct and efforts will always be appreciated! Respect for you ! Love you bro,” Riaz posted on Twitter.

Earlier, Afridi had stated the rehab course of was a really robust part for him and he missed enjoying cricket for Pakistan.

“It was very a tough phase in the rehab process and I missed playing on the field. But despite being away from the game I did call my teammates at times and spoke to them,” stated Afridi.
